A free Eye Camp was held in the premises of Karmirhath Hospital on August 3, 2010. Out of total 600 patients, 53 were detected with cataract. These patients were tested for blood-sugar and other probable ailments. Cataract surgeries were conducted on 25 patients on August 4 and on the remaining 28 patients on August 11, 2010. Each surgery was conducted by a team of three experienced surgeons and doctors and all operations were successful. All the 53 patients have their eye sights restored and each and every happy patient was extremely grateful to the donors who made their operations possible through their liberal donations!!!
